An art museum has 20 large cylindrical columns in its lobby. Each column has a height of 22 feet from
Firdavs [7]

A cylinder is a three-dimensional structure formed by two parallel circular bases connected by a curving surface. The amount of paint needed to paint 20 pillars is 9.874 gallons.

<h3>What is a cylinder?</h3>

A cylinder is a three-dimensional structure formed by two parallel circular bases connected by a curving surface. The circular bases' centers overlap each other to form a right cylinder.

The curved surface area of a single-cylinder with a diameter of 2.5 feet and a height of 22 feet will be,

Curved surface area = πDh = π × 2.5 × 22 = 172.7875 ft²

The total area of 20 pillar = 20 × 172.7875 ft² = 3,455.75191 ft²

Since a gallon of paint can cover only 350 ft², therefore, the amount of paint that will be needed to paint 3,455.75191 ft² can be written as,

\text{Amount of paint needed} = \dfrac{3,455.75191\rm\ ft^2}{350\rm\ ft^2} = 9.874\rm\ gallons

Hence, the amount of paint needed to paint 20 pillars is 9.874 gallons.
